Tuesday: Taste of Adams Morgan
If 14th Street’s growing variety of restaurants are not be enough for your culinary needs, then take a short walk north on Tuesday, May 21. Taste of Adams Morgan brings together neighborhood favorites to benefit Mary’s Center.
Mary’s Center provides health care, family literacy and social services to individuals whose needs too often go unmet by the public and private systems. Mary’s Center uses a holistic, multipronged approach to help each participant access individualized services that set them on the path toward good health, stable families, and economic independence. The Center offers high-quality, professional care in a safe and trusting environment to residents from the entire DC metropolitan region, including individuals from over 110 countries.
